THREATENED SPECIES CONSERVATION (BIODIVERSITY BANKING) REGULATION 2008 - REG 52

Withdrawal of applications

52 Withdrawal of applications

(1) An application under Part 7A of the Act may be withdrawn at any time prior to its determination by service on the Minister or the Director-General of a notice to that effect signed by the applicant.
(2) In this clause, an "application under Part 7A of the Act" means:
(a) an application to enter into a biobanking agreement, or
(b) an application for consent to the variation of a biobanking agreement, or
(c) an application to retire a biodiversity credit, or
(d) an application for the issue, or modification or revocation, of a biobanking statement.
